Dillian Whyte appears to have signed up to fight a giant. 


Mariusz Wach, who has probably the best chin I have ever seen in boxing. His problem is that he just lets people repeatedly punch him in the head and gets himself stopped (see Bakole and Miller fights). His other stoppage loss was against Povetkin where the doctor recommended the fight go to the cards in the 11th (or 12th?) round but Wach said there was no point as he was clearly 11 rounds down and quit, resulting in a TKO.

The amount of constant punches he took from Wlad over 12 rounds in their title fight was fucking crazy.
